As reported in bug 112841, typeof_unqual fails to remove qualifiers from qualified array types. In C23 (unlike in previous standard versions), array types are considered to have the qualifiers of the element type, so typeof_unqual should remove such qualifiers (and an example in the standard shows that is as intended). Fix this by calling strip_array_types when checking for the presence of qualifiers. (The reason we check for qualifiers rather than just using TYPE_MAIN_VARIANT unconditionally is to avoid, as a quality of implementation matter, unnecessarily losing typedef information in the case where the type is already unqualified.)
